Top 10 Tips for Creating Stunning Maps in CSGO Workshop
Creating stunning maps in the CSGO Workshop requires a combination of creativity and technical skills. Here are your top 10 tips to get started:
- Research the fundamentals: Understand the basic mechanics of mapping and how players interact with environments in CSGO.
- Sketch your ideas: Before diving into the editor, sketch out your map layout on paper to visualize the flow and key points.
- Use reference images: Gather inspiration from both real-life locations and existing maps.
- Keep it balanced: Ensure there’s a balance between Terrorist and Counter-Terrorist spawn points for fair gameplay.
Once you’ve established the basics, enhance your map further with advanced techniques. For example:
- Lighting is key: Use lighting to create mood and guide players through the map.
- Optimize for performance: Always consider the hardware capabilities of players to ensure smooth gameplay.
- Test extensively: Invite friends or community members to playtest your map and provide feedback.
- Iterate based on feedback: Don’t be afraid to make changes based on player experiences.
By following these tips, you can create a captivating and engaging map for the CSGO Workshop that not only stands out visually but also offers a great gameplay experience.

What Makes a Map Great? Key Features to Consider in CSGO Workshop
Creating a map for CSGO is an intricate process that requires a keen understanding of what makes a game environment not just playable, but also enjoyable. One of the key features to consider is balance. In a well-balanced map, both teams have equal opportunities to succeed, which enhances competitive play. Additionally, the layout should promote strategic gameplay, with various paths and vantage points that encourage players to explore and adapt their tactics. Essential elements like spawn points, bomb sites, and choke points must be purposefully placed to create dynamic engagements. A great map strikes a balance between open spaces for combat and enclosed areas for tactical maneuvers.
Another crucial aspect of a great CSGO map is visual clarity. Players should be able to quickly recognize their surroundings and identify important features, such as bomb sites and cover options. This not only aids in gameplay but also immerses players in the map's aesthetic. Additionally, incorporating unique themes and engaging lore can enhance a player's connection to the map. To create longevity in the workshop's content, maps should facilitate a variety of playstyles, from sniping positions to close-quarters combat. Ultimately, the synergy between design, balance, and visual appeal makes for a truly great map that players will enjoy returning to.
